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

Access_201014_06

.pdf
Скачиваний:
30
Добавлен:
03.05.2015
Размер:
2.66 Mб
Скачать

-Используя инструменты группы Колонтитулы на вкладке Конструктор, можно добавить в форму эмблему компании, заголовок или дату и время.

-Для добавления в форму элементов управления других типов используются инструменты группы Элементы управления на вкладке Конструктор.

6. Сводная диаграмма Сводные диаграммы служат для наглядного графического

представления анализируемой информации, облегчая для пользователей сравнение и выявление тенденций и закономерностей в данных.

7. Сводная таблица Сводная таблица представляет собой интерактивную таблицу, с

помощью которой можно анализировать данные, быстро объединяя большие объемы данных и рассчитывая итоги. С помощью сводных таблиц выполнение сложного анализа данных делается легко.

Для получения различных итогов по исходным данным достаточно в созданном макете сводной таблицы выбирать значения в поле строк, поле столбцов и поле страницы (фильтра).

Сводные таблицы позволяют динамически изменять макет для всестороннего анализа данных. Существует возможность изменять заголовки строк, столбцов, а также полей, определяющих страницу. Создавать и быстро модифицировать макет можно, выбирая и перетаскивая поля из раскрывающегося списка полей в рабочую область. При каждом изменении макета сводная таблица немедленно выполняет вычисления заново в соответствии с новым расположением данных.

8. Мастер форм Для получения большей свободы выбора полей, отображаемых на

форме, вместо упомянутых выше инструментов можно воспользоваться мастером форм. Кроме того, можно указать способ группировки и сортировки данных, а также включить в форму поля из нескольких таблиц или запросов при условии, что заранее заданы отношения между этими таблицами и запросами.

-На вкладке Создание в группе Формы нажать кнопку Мастер

форм.

-Следовать инструкциям на страницах мастера форм.

Для добавления в форму полей из нескольких таблиц или запросов не нажимать кнопки Далее или Готово после выбора полей из первой таблицы или запроса на первой странице мастера форм. Повторить

21

действия для выбора другой таблицы или запроса и щелкнуть все дополнительные поля, которые требуется включить в форму. Чтобы продолжить, нажать кнопку Далее или Готово.

- На последней странице мастера нажать кнопку Готово.

9. Конструктор форм Режим конструктора обеспечивает более подробное представление

структуры формы. В нем отображаются разделы колонтитулов и данных формы. В этом режиме форма не выполняется, поэтому при внесении изменений невозможно просмотреть соответствующие данные. Однако некоторые задачи удобнее выполнять в режиме конструктора, например следующие:

-добавление в форму дополнительных элементов управления, таких как границы привязанных объектов, разрывы страниц и диаграммы;

-изменение источников элемента управления "текстовое поле" непосредственно в самом поле, без использования окна свойств;

-изменение размеров разделов формы, таких как "Заголовок формы" или "Область данных".

Создание отчета

Отчет это еще один вид представления информации, но, в отличие от формы, содержит результаты анализа данных и вычислений. В отчете пользователь может наглядно представить извлеченную из базы данных информацию, дополнив ее результатами анализа и вычислений. Пользователь свободен в выборе макета отчета и его оформления. В MS Access предусмотрены некоторые стандартные компоненты структуры отчета (шапки, примечания, колонтитулы, основная часть), однако каким именно будет макет отчета - решает пользователь.

Отчеты позволяют выбирать из БД требуемую пользователю информацию, оформить ее в виде документа и распечатать. Источником данных может быть таблица, запрос или несколько взаимосвязанных таблиц. Отчеты и формы имеют много общего, но в отличие от форм отчеты не предназначены для ввода и корректировки данных. Разделы отчета подобны разделам форм.

В процессе конструирования отчета формируется состав и содержимое разделов отчета, размещение в нем значений, выводимых из полей связанных таблиц БД формируются заголовки, размещаются вычисляемые поля. Средства конструирования отчета позволяют группировать данные по нескольким уровням. Для каждого уровня может производиться вычисление итогов, определяться заголовки и примечания.

22

Сконструировать макет отчета можно двумя способами: с помощью Мастера отчетов или самостоятельно. Начинающим пользователям Мастер отчетов помогает избежать ошибок. Во втором случае пользователь обладает более широкими возможностями. Однако возможен и промежуточный вариант: можно использовать помощь Мастера для создания «заготовки» отчета, а затем самостоятельно доработать этот отчет, внеся необходимые дополнения и изменения. Это наиболее рациональный способ.

Рассмотрим подробнее конструирование макета отчета с помощью Мастера.

Мастер отчетов помогает спроектировать отчет, ставя вопросы, касающиеся структуры, содержания и оформления отчета. Проведя с помощью серии диалоговых окон своеобразное «интервью», предлагая при этом на выбор возможные варианты ответов и демонстрируя возможные результаты выбора того или иного варианта ответа, Мастер формирует макет отчета.

Часть 2 Лабораторная работа № 1

Создание таблиц

1.Запустить программу MS ACCESS.

2.В появившемся окне выделить «Новая база данных» и подтвердить операцию, нажав кнопку Создать в нижней правой части окна.

3.В следующем окне появится пустая Таблица 1. Перейти в режим Конструктора с помощью контекстного меню или выбрав Режимы в меню Главная.

4.В появившемся диалоговом окне задать название таблицы Страны Европы и нажать кнопку ОК.

5.В столбец «имя поля» будут заноситься имена столбцов будущей таблицы (при этом нельзя использовать некоторые символы, в том числе точки и запятые). В столбце «тип данных» выбираются (с использованием кнопки вызова списка) тип данных. А то, что заносится в столбец «описание», затем появляется в виде комментариев в строке состояния (для проверки в одной из строк этого столбца напишите фразу: моя первая база данных).

Как видно, из ниже перечисленных данных, необходимо создать следующие поля:

23

Рисунок 14 - Создание таблицы в режиме конструктора

Данные для ввода:

 

Австрия

Албания

Площадь 83 871 кв. км

Площадь 28 748 кв. км

Столица Вена

Столица Тирана

Число жителей 8 460 390

Число жителей 3 152 000

Основная религия Христианство

Основная религия Ислам

(католики)

Денежная единица Лек

Денежная единица Евро

Гос. строй Республика

Гос. строй Республика

 

Андорра

Белоруссия

Площадь 468 кв. км

Площадь 207 600 кв. км

Столица Андорра-ла-Велья

Столица Минск

Число жителей 83 100

Число жителей 9 463 300

Основная религия Христианство

Основная религия Христианство

(католики)

(православные)

Денежная единица Евро

Денежная единица Рубль

Гос. строй Княжество

Гос. строй Республика

24

Бельгия

Болгария

Площадь 30 528 кв. км

Площадь 110 550 кв. км

Столица Брюссель

Столица София

Число жителей 10 951 000

Число жителей 7 364 570

Основная религия Христианство

Основная религия Христианство

(католики)

(православные)

Денежная единица Евро

Денежная единица Лев

Гос. строй Монархия

Гос. строй Республика

Босния и Герцеговина

Ватикан

Площадь 51 197 кв. км

Площадь 0,44 кв. км

Столица Сараево

Столица Ватикан

Число жителей 3 839 737

Число жителей 836

Основная религия Ислам

Основная религия Христианство

Денежная единица Марка

(католики)

Гос. строй Республика

Денежная единица Евро

 

Гос. строй Монархия

Великобритания

Венгрия

Площадь 243 809 кв. км

Площадь 93 030 кв. км

Столица Лондон

Столица Будапешт

Число жителей 63 181 775

Число жителей 9 935 000

Основная религия Христианство

Основная религия Христианство

(протестанты)

(католики)

Денежная единица Фунт

Денежная единица Форинт

Гос. строй Монархия

Гос. строй Республика

Германия

Греция

Площадь 357 021 кв. км

Площадь 131 957 кв. км

Столица Берлин

Столица Афины

Число жителей 81 903 000

Число жителей 10 787 690

Основная религия Христианство

Основная религия Христианство

(протестанты)

(православные)

Денежная единица Евро

Денежная единица Евро

Гос. строй Республика

Гос. строй Республика

25

Дания

Ирландия

Площадь 43 094 кв. км

Площадь 70 273 кв. км

Столица Копенгаген

Столица Дублин

Число жителей 5 587 000

Число жителей 4 581 269

Основная религия Христианство

Основная религия Христианство

(протестанты)

(католики)

Денежная единица Крона

Денежная единица Евро

Гос. строй Монархия

Гос. строй Республика

Исландия

Испания

Площадь 103 000 кв. км

Площадь 504 782 кв. км

Столица Рейкьявик

Столица Мадрид

Число жителей 319 575

Число жителей 47 190 500

Основная религия Христианство

Основная религия Христианство

(протестанты)

(католики)

Денежная единица Крона

Денежная единица Евро

Гос. строй Республика

Гос. строй Монархия

Италия

Латвия

Площадь 309 547 кв. км

Площадь 64 589 кв. км

Столица Рим

Столица Рига

Число жителей 59 570 581

Число жителей 2 201 196

Основная религия Христианство

Основная религия Христианство

(католики)

(протестанты)

Денежная единица Евро

Денежная единица Лат

Гос. строй Республика

Гос. строй Республика

Литва

Лихтенштейн

Площадь 65 200 кв. км

Площадь 160 кв. км

Столица Вильнюс

Столица Вадуц

Число жителей 3 054 000

Число жителей 36 476

Основная религия Христианство

Основная религия Христианство

(католики)

(католики)

Денежная единица Лит

Денежная единица Франк

Гос. строй Республика

Гос. строй Монархия

26

Люксембург

Македония

Площадь 2 586 кв. км

Площадь 25 333 кв. км

Столица Люксембург

Столица Скопье

Число жителей 502 207

Число жителей 2 057 284

Основная религия Христианство

Основная религия Христианство

(католики)

(православные)

Денежная единица Евро

Денежная единица Денар

Гос. строй Герцогство

Гос. строй Республика

Мальта

Молдавия

Площадь 316 кв. км

Площадь 33 846 кв. км

Столица Валлетта

Столица Кишинёв

Число жителей 452 515

Число жителей 3 559 500

Основная религия Христианство

Основная религия Христианство

(католики)

(православные)

Денежная единица Евро

Денежная единица Лей

Гос. строй Республика

Гос. строй Республика

Монако

Нидерланды

Площадь 2 кв. км

Площадь 41 526 кв. км

Столица Монако

Столица Амстердам

Число жителей 35 986

Число жителей 16 743 507

Основная религия Христианство

Основная религия Христианство

(католики)

(католики)

Денежная единица Евро

Денежная единица Евро

Гос. строй Княжество

Гос. строй Монархия

Норвегия

Польша

Площадь 385 186 кв. км

Площадь 312 679 кв. км

Столица Осло

Столица Варшава

Число жителей 5 047 400

Число жителей 8 501 000

Основная религия Христианство

Основная религия Христианство

(протестанты)

(католики)

Денежная единица Крона

Денежная единица Злотый

Гос. строй Монархия

Госстрой Республика

27

Португалия

Румыния

Площадь 92 151 кв. км

Площадь 238 391 кв. км

Столица Лиссабон

Столица Бухарест

Число жителей 10 707 924

Число жителей 19 042 936

Основная религия Христианство

Основная религия Христианство

(католики)

(православные)

Денежная единица Евро

Денежная единица Лей

Гос. строй Республика

Гос. строй Республика

Сан-Марино

Сербия

Площадь 61 кв. км

Площадь 88 361 кв. км

Столица Сан-Марино

Столица Белград

Число жителей 32 075

Число жителей 7 186 862

Основная религия Христианство

Основная религия Христианство

(католики)

(православные)

Денежная единица Евро

Денежная единица Динар

Гос. строй Республика

Гос. строй Республика

Словакия

Словения

Площадь 49 034 кв. км

Площадь 20 253 кв. км

Столица Братислава

Столица Любляна

Число жителей 5 400 536

Число жителей 2 055 496

Основная религия Христианство

Основная религия Христианство

(католики)

(католики)

Денежная единица Евро

Денежная единица Евро

Гос. строй Республика

Гос. строй Республика

Украина

Финляндия

Площадь 603 549 кв. км

Площадь 338 430 кв. км

Столица Киев

Столица Хельсинки

Число жителей 45 553 000

Число жителей 5 429 894

Основная религия Христианство

Основная религия Христианство

(православные)

(протестанты)

Денежная единица Гривна

Денежная единица Евро

Гос. строй Республика

Гос. строй Республика

28

Франция

Черногория

Площадь 547 030 кв. км

Площадь 13 812 кв. км

Столица Париж

Столица Подгорица

Число жителей 63 460 000

Число жителей 626 000

Основная религия Христианство

Основная религия Христианство

(католики)

(православные)

Денежная единица Евро

Денежная единица Евро

Гос. строй Республика

Гос. строй Республика

Чехия

Хорватия

Площадь 78 866 кв. км

Площадь 56 594 кв. км

Столица Прага

Столица Загреб

Число жителей 10 505 445

Число жителей 4 290 612

Основная религия Христианство

Основная религия Христианство

(католики)

(католики)

Денежная единица Крона

Денежная единица Куна

Гос. строй Республика

Гос. строй Республика

Швейцария

Швеция

Площадь 41 284 кв. км

Площадь 449 964 кв. км

Столица Берн

Столица Стокгольм

Число жителей 7 700 200

Число жителей 9 532 634

Основная религия Христианство

Основная религия Христианство

(католики)

(протестанты)

Денежная единица Франк

Денежная единица Крона

Гос. строй Республика

Гос. строй Монархия

Эстония

 

Площадь 45 226 кв. км

 

Столица Таллинн

 

Число жителей 1 286 540

 

Основная религия Христианство

 

(протестанты)

 

Денежная единица Евро

 

Гос. строй Республика

 

После ввода полей и типов данных желательно задать ключевое поле. Так как значения в ключевом поле должны быть уникальными, т.е. не повторяющимися, то в этом качестве следует выбрать поле Код_страны.

29

1.Для этого необходимо щелкнуть правой клавишей мыши по заданному полю и в появившемся меню выполнить команду ключевое поле.

2.Закрыть окно конструктора.

3.Открыть таблицу для заполнения данными (надо заметить, что поле с типом данных Счетчик будет заполняться автоматически).

4.Посчитать максимальное количество символов в каждом из полей

стекстовыми данными и, на всякий случай, прибавить к значениям 5.

5.Открыть таблицу в режиме конструктора.

6.По очереди, переводя текстовый курсор в каждое из текстовых полей, задать в окне свойств поля его размер (значения из пункта 10).

7.Просмотреть, какие еще настройки можно задавать текстовым

полям.

8.Просмотреть, какие настройки можно задавать другим полям.

9.Закрыть таблицу с сохранением.

10.Сохранить данную базу данных под именем Европа в папке с фамилией в папке «Мои документы» для следующей лабораторной работы.

Лабораторная работа № 2 Реляционные базы данных

Разделение данных на две таблицы

1.Открыть базу данных Европа.

2.Создать таблицу Религия с полями:

Название поля

Тип данных

Код религии

Счетчик

Религия

Текстовый

3.Поле Код религии сделать ключевым.

4.Создать таблицу Строй с полями:

Название поля

Тип данных

Код строя

Счетчик

Строй

Текстовый

5.Поле Код строя сделать ключевым.

6.Заполнить эти таблицы (таким образом, напротив каждой религии и каждого строя будет стоять его код).

30

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]